Subject: [PATCH v3 3/3] cat-file: add "--literally" option

made changes to "cat-file" to include a "--literally"
option which prints the type of the object without any
complaints.

---
 builtin/cat-file.c | 25 +++++++++++++++++++++----
 1 file changed, 21 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/builtin/cat-file.c b/builtin/cat-file.c
index df99df4..60b9ec4 100644
--- a/builtin/cat-file.c
+++ b/builtin/cat-file.c
@@ -9,7 +9,8 @@
 #include "userdiff.h"
 #include "streaming.h"
 
-static int cat_one_file(int opt, const char *exp_type, const char *obj_name)
+static int cat_one_file(int opt, const char *exp_type, const char *obj_name,
+			int literally)
 {
 	unsigned char sha1[20];
 	enum object_type type;
@@ -23,6 +24,14 @@ static int cat_one_file(int opt, const char *exp_type, const char *obj_name)
 	buf = NULL;
 	switch (opt) {
 	case 't':
+		if (literally) {
+			buf = sha1_object_info_literally(sha1);
+			if (!buf)
+				die("git cat-file --literally -t %s: failed",
+					obj_name);
+			printf("%s\n", buf);
+			return 0;
+		}
 		type = sha1_object_info(sha1, NULL);
 		if (type > 0) {
 			printf("%s\n", typename(type));
@@ -323,7 +332,7 @@ static int batch_objects(struct batch_options *opt)
 }
 
 static const char * const cat_file_usage[] = {
-	N_("git cat-file (-t | -s | -e | -p | <type> | --textconv) <object>"),
+	N_("git cat-file (-t|-s|-e|-p|<type>|--textconv|-t --literally) <object>"),
 	N_("git cat-file (--batch | --batch-check) < <list-of-objects>"),
 	NULL
 };
@@ -359,6 +368,7 @@ int cmd_cat_file(int argc, const char **argv, const char *prefix)
 	int opt = 0;
 	const char *exp_type = NULL, *obj_name = NULL;
 	struct batch_options batch = {0};
+	int literally = 0;
 
 	const struct option options[] = {
 		OPT_GROUP(N_("<type> can be one of: blob, tree, commit, tag")),
@@ -369,6 +379,8 @@ int cmd_cat_file(int argc, const char **argv, const char *prefix)
 		OPT_SET_INT('p', NULL, &opt, N_("pretty-print object's content"), 'p'),
 		OPT_SET_INT(0, "textconv", &opt,
 			    N_("for blob objects, run textconv on object's content"), 'c'),
+		OPT_BOOL( 0, "literally", &literally,
+			  N_("show the type of the given loose object, use for debugging")),
 		{ OPTION_CALLBACK, 0, "batch", &batch, "format",
 			N_("show info and content of objects fed from the standard input"),
 			PARSE_OPT_OPTARG, batch_option_callback },
@@ -380,7 +392,7 @@ int cmd_cat_file(int argc, const char **argv, const char *prefix)
 
 	git_config(git_cat_file_config, NULL);
 
-	if (argc != 3 && argc != 2)
+	if (argc != 3 && argc != 2 && argc != 4)
 		usage_with_options(cat_file_usage, options);
 
 	argc = parse_options(argc, argv, prefix, options, cat_file_usage, 0);
@@ -405,5 +417,10 @@ int cmd_cat_file(int argc, const char **argv, const char *prefix)
 	if (batch.enabled)
 		return batch_objects(&batch);
 
-	return cat_one_file(opt, exp_type, obj_name);
+	if (literally && opt == 't')
+		return cat_one_file(opt, exp_type, obj_name, literally);
+	else if (literally)
+		usage_with_options(cat_file_usage, options);
+
+	return cat_one_file(opt, exp_type, obj_name, literally);
 }
